Debug
Enable CATC debug file
Checking this box enables the creation of a file that can be used by CATC
Support to aid in debugging. This option should always be disabled unless
you are requested to enable it by CATC personnel.
6.4 Recording Options - Piconet
The Recording Options dialog box has two pages for configuring how
Bluetooth traffic is recorded: Piconet, which configures piconet recording
sessions, and Inquiry which configures inquiry recording sessions.
For recording in Piconet mode, the Piconet page lets you specify the type of
piconet you will be recording and how Merlin II should synchronize and
record the piconet.
Frequency Hopping
Stay with Basic Hopping - Configures the probe to use the Basic Hopping
sequence as defined by the Bluetooth 1.1 specification.
Follow AFH - Configures the probe to use the Adaptive Frequency Hopping
sequence as defined by the Bluetooth 1.2 specification.
